The Blue Diamond Previews will command much attention at Caulfield as a host of juveniles try to press their claims for Melbourne's richest two-year-old race next month.
Tuesday's program at Caulfield features the Listed Blue Diamond Preview for colts and geldings (1000m) and the Group Three Preview for fillies over the same distance.
It kicks off this year's Blue Diamond series with the respective Preludes to be run on February 13, two weeks before the $1.5 million Group One Blue Diamond (1200m).
The Paul Messara-trained debutant Weatherly is the slight favourite at $4 for the males' Preview ahead of Maribyrnong Plate winner Power Trip and Godolphin colt Cohesion.
The fillies Preview has attracted a big field with the Mathew Ellerton and Simon Zahra-trained Sword Of Light holding favouritism in an open market at $6.50.
The Mick Price-trained Extreme Choice is the $5 Blue Diamond favourite and is expected to have his lead-up in the Group Three Chairman's Stakes (1000m) at Caulfield on Saturday week while $7 second favourite Defcon is nominated to make his debut in the Canonbury Stakes in Sydney on Saturday.
Tuesday's eight-race Caulfield meeting also includes the Listed John Dillon Stakes (1400m).
